Identifying fakeouts and avoiding false breakouts are critical skills for any cryptocurrency trader. In the volatile world of digital currencies, price movements can often be misleading, leading to premature trades and financial losses. A fakeout occurs when a cryptocurrency’s price briefly breaks out of a support or resistance level but then quickly reverses, tricking traders into making unprofitable decisions. Recognizing these deceptive patterns can help traders make more informed decisions and protect their investments.
Understanding False Breakouts
False breakouts often happen when the price moves beyond key support or resistance levels, prompting traders to assume a trend reversal or continuation. These breakouts, however, are often short-lived and lead to a sudden reversal, trapping those who entered trades prematurely. A key indicator of a false breakout is the lack of significant volume accompanying the move, as real breakouts usually come with an increase in trading volume.
Key Indicators of Fakeouts
Traders can identify fakeouts by observing several key factors. The first is the volume: a genuine breakout is supported by substantial trading volume. The second is the timeframe: shorter timeframes are more prone to fakeouts due to market noise. Lastly, traders should look for confirmation from additional technical indicators, such as RSI or MACD, to ensure that the breakout is legitimate.
How to Avoid False Breakouts
To avoid falling for false breakouts, traders should wait for price confirmation. This includes waiting for the price to stay above or below key levels for an extended period, ideally with strong volume backing the move. Additionally, using stop-loss orders can help minimize losses if the price moves against the position.
In conclusion, recognizing fakeouts and avoiding false breakouts requires patience, understanding of market behavior, and a keen eye for technical indicators. By staying vigilant and following disciplined trading strategies, traders can reduce the risk of costly mistakes in the unpredictable crypto market.
